The Senior Manager, Engineering is responsible for providing reliable and safe engineering track infrastructure to maximize network availability and train velocity to support operations. The incumbent delivers improved efficiency in the designated region.

Main ResponsibilitiesStaff Management

· Lead Managers, Track Supervisors, Assistant Track Supervisors and hourly Maintenance of Way (MOW) employees across the territory, managing performance, encouraging development, and creating strategies to retain talent

· Provide clear direction and communication on employee performance and department goals

· Lead succession and talent management initiatives

· Coach and counsel subordinates who are not performing at established goals and standards

· Partner with Labor Relations (LR) to identify root causes and resolve grievance issues across the territory

· Engage with workforce through coaching, feedback and two-way dialogue

Safety Compliance

· Develop a safe environment for injuries and accidents across the territory

· Ensure a standardized focus on the elimination of Serious Injury Fatality (SIF) potential injuries

· Implement a standardized process to reduce and eliminate track unit collisions and Main Track Authority Violations (MTAV)

· Drive compliance to regulations and the Engineering Tracks Standards (ETS)

· Ensure territorial compliance with quality Exposure Reduction discussion (ERD), Job Safety Briefing (JSB) and Field Verification of Life Critical Rules (FVLCR) meeting required Key Performance Indicators (KPIs)

Capital Program

· Maintain effective labor management and carry out capital projects to ensure improved productivity

· Oversee yearly operating and capital budgets as well as drive efficiencies to improve performance

· Prepare capital program requirements

· Analyze and interpret track geometry and rail flaw reports to identify conditions requiring actions to meet ETS

Operations

· Manage activities related to derailments and disruptions in service while collaborating with others to determine cause and future prevention

Working Conditions

The role has standard working conditions in an office environment with a regular workweek from Monday to Friday. The role requires being available on-call 24/7 to respond to critical incidences. The role requires frequent travel (50%) within the region.

About CN

CN is a world-class transportation leader and trade-enabler. Essential to the economy, to the customers, and to the communities it serves, CN safely transports more than 300 million tons of natural resources, manufactured products, and finished goods throughout North America every year. As the only railroad connecting Canada's Eastern and Western coasts with the Southern tip of the U.S. through a 19,500 mile rail network, CN and its affiliates have been contributing to community prosperity and sustainable trade since 1919.
